What is a Virtual Technology professional?

A Virtual Technology professional specializes in implementing, managing, and supporting virtualized environments and technologies. This can include virtualization of servers, desktops, networks, and storage using platforms like VMware, Hyper-V, or cloud-based services. They ensure that virtual systems run efficiently, securely, and are scalable to an organization’s needs. These professionals play a key role in reducing hardware requirements, improving disaster recovery, and enabling flexible, remote computing solutions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Virtual Technology Spec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Virtual Technology Specialist, you need expertise in virtualization platforms, networking, cloud computing, and typically a bachelor's deg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with tools such as VMware, Microsoft Hyper-V, Citrix, and relevant certifications like VMware Certified Professional (VCP) or Microsoft Certified: Azure Administrator Associate are highly valued. Strong problem-solving abilities, communication skills, and adaptability help professionals effectively support clients and collaborate with teams. These skills are crucial for ensuring reliable, scalable, and secure virtual environments that meet organizational needs.

A DAY IN THE LIFE OF A REMOTE IT OPERATIONS SPECIALIST

The IT Operations Specialist plays a key role in supporting both our clients and internal teams. This position combines client onboarding, account access management, technical support, and process improvement. You'll work directly with clients to gain access to financial, eCommerce, banking, and business systems, helping our accounting teams get the access they need to serve clients effectively. You'll also support internal IT operations and assist with automation projects that improve efficiency across the organization.

As one of the first LedgerGurus team members many clients interact with, you'll help create a positive first impression through clear communication, professionalism, and problem-solving.
